Seasonal Backend Developer Python information

What is a seasonal backend developer python?

Seasonal Backend Developer Python jobs are temporary positions where developers use the Python programming language to build and maintain server-side applications for a specific period, often aligned with a company’s peak business season. These roles typically involve working on APIs, databases, and backend logic to support web or mobile applications. Employers seek individuals who can quickly adapt, contribute to ongoing projects, and help handle increased workloads during busy times, such as holidays or special events. Candidates should have strong Python skills, familiarity with backend frameworks like Django or Flask, and experience working with databases and cloud platforms.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a seasonal backend developer python?

To excel as a Seasonal Backend Developer Python, you need strong proficiency in Python programming, backend frameworks (such as Django or Flask), and experience with databases, usually supported by a relevant degree or equivalent experience. Familiarity with version control systems like Git, cloud platforms such as AWS or Azure, and containerization tools like Docker is often required. Problem-solving, effective time management, and teamwork are vital soft skills for handling project deadlines and collaborating remotely or with cross-functional teams. These skills ensure efficient, scalable backend solutions that meet seasonal business demands and integrate seamlessly with broader systems.

What are some typical challenges faced by a seasonal backend developer python, and how can applicants prepare for them?

Seasonal Backend Developers working with Python often face tight project timelines and the need to quickly adapt to existing codebases. Since the role is temporary, ramping up effectively and collaborating with permanent team members are essential. Applicants can prepare by familiarizing themselves with common Python frameworks (such as Django or Flask), practicing reading and debugging unfamiliar code, and honing their communication skills to integrate smoothly with established workflows. Being proactive in asking questions and seeking documentation can make the transition faster and more effective.

Senior Application Developer - Charles River Development (CRD)

Fisher Investments Careers

Portland, OR • Hybrid

Full-time

Medical, Dental, Vision, Retirement, PTO

Posted 7 days ago


Job description

We are looking for a Senior Application Developer to join our Charles River Development (CRIMS) team within Fisher Investments Technology. You will combine deep business domain expertise with hands‑on technical skills using Java, Python, C#, SQL, REST APIs, and CRD's own API and automation frameworks.

The Opportunity:

You will support Charles River–driven workflows across Portfolio Engineering, Optimization, Guidelines, Implementation, Trading, and Trade Operations. You will collaborate with Portfolio Managers, Traders, and Technology teams to implement CRD enhancements, API integrations, portfolio optimization workflows, and automation solutions. You'll report to the AVP – PMG Technology Services

The Day-to-Day:

  • Lead end-to-end delivery of CRD enhancements: requirements, design, CRD configuration, integrations, testing, deployment, and ongoing support
  • Configure Manager Work Bench or Central Work Bench layouts, workflows, rules, and result sets
  • Hands-on work with the Charles River API Framework, including:
    • Frontend APIs – UI workflows, triggers, CRD interaction points
    • Backend APIs – data calls, order submissions, guideline checks, reference data, trading flows
  • Build and support integration workflows using REST APIs, services, and messaging frameworks
  • Apply working knowledge of portfolio optimization concepts (risk models, constraints, exposures, and transaction cost analysis)
  • Familiarity with industry optimization platforms including Axioma (portfolio construction, risk model integration) and OMEGA Point (optimization and risk analytics tools)
  • Collaborate with Portfolio Engineering teams to support optimization workflows feeding CRD
  • Ensure Start‑of‑Day readiness for CRD and support ongoing system stability
  • Translate our requirements into detailed functional and technical specifications, user stories, diagrams, and interface documentation

Your Qualifications:

  • 10+ years experience in Application Development:
    • Advanced SQL – complex queries, performance tuning
    • Java or C# – ability to interpret, collaborate, and support integrations
    • REST API integration, testing, and troubleshooting
  • 5+ experience in:
    • Python Programming
    • Investment/Wealth Management industry
  • 3+ years’ experience in CRD or any other Order Management System (OMS) Implementation / Customization , Workbench (Manager or Central) configuration experience
  • Experience with Order Management System (OMS) Batch Automation, including monitoring and exception handling
  • Hands-on experience with the Order Management System API Framework (frontend and backend)
  • Familiarity with portfolio optimization concepts (risk factors, constraints, optimization models)
  • Experience with optimization tools such as Axioma and OMET/Gap Point.
  • Experience with Order Management workflows, markets, and trading processes (Equities & Fixed Income)
  • Experience using Agile SDLC, process diagramming, and workflow mapping.
  • Bachelor's degree in finance, Economics, Computer Science, Engineering, Math, or equivalent
